What is Union Rep Nomination
The Nomination for Union Representatives is an employment form used by the Queensland Teachers' Union to nominate candidates for Union Representatives in schools or workplaces.

Who is eligible to fill out the Nomination for Union Representatives form?
All members of the Queensland Teachers' Union are eligible to fill out the Nomination for Union Representatives form to nominate themselves or others for election as union representatives.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
The deadline for submitting the Nomination for Union Representatives form varies each election cycle, so it's essential to check the Queensland Teachers' Union website or contact the union for the specific cut-off dates.
